Transaction 18db56ea5f1947628cc89146687ded4694834d8068320615e7e60ff0f1c9455e
1 Input
1 Output
-
18db56ea5f1947628cc89146687ded4694834d8068320615e7e60ff0f1c9455e:0
- value
- 2295772
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5009bcafadc2f0dade6d66a809ba4ba62413e801 OP_EQUAL
- address
- 38zDeS3maoDabJCGFMQvdgvaREDBpxUAW1